ALARM SYSTEM WITH FIRST RESPONDER CODE FOR BUILDING ACCESS
20220148413 · 2022-05-12 · ·

A building alarm system and automated door lock arranged to place the alarm system in an armed state when a door lock fails to engage to lock an associated door in a closed position. Activation of a single button by a user or use of specific code by a user to gain access to a building can cause the alarm system to automatically rearm and for door locks at the building to be locked after entry by the user. A first responder code can be used by first responder personnel to gain access to a building after an alarm system indicates an alarm state, e.g., that corresponds to an emergency condition.

COVERT PERSONAL SAFETY DEVICE AND SYSTEM
20220148414 · 2022-05-12 ·

In one implementation, there is a personal safety device and system that permits for an inconspicuously worn device to be discreetly triggered to alert a third party of a threat to the wearer's personal safety. In at least one implementation, the personal safety device takes the form of a piece of jewelry (e.g. bracelet, necklace, etc.) that sends a wireless signal to a host device once a portion of the piece of jewelry is separated from the rest of the jewelry component. The alert may be forwarded to emergency services thereby allowing them to respond to the wearer's location.

MOBILE PERSONAL-SAFETY APPARATUS
20220139204 · 2022-05-05 ·

A wearable apparatus for personal safety has a scene monitor for sensing an ambient environment, and a main controller for processing the scene data. An emergency condition adverse to a user is detected by processing captured images of the ambient environment to determine whether a violent movement signifying the user facing an attack or accident has occurred. Motion data measured by a motion sensor in the apparatus can be used, alone or with captured images, to assist this determination. Upon detection of the emergency condition, the apparatus automatically sends scene data most-recently obtained before the emergency condition occurs to a remote server for securely storing these scene data for future uses even if the apparatus is subsequently damaged by, e. g., an attacker. The sending of scene data is automatic without a need for the user to initiate. Microphone, hazardous-gas sensor, etc. may also be used in sensing the ambient environment.

VOICE ACTIVATION OF AN ALARM VIA A COMMUNICATION NETWORK
20220130224 · 2022-04-28 ·

A method for activating an alarm is described. The method is performed by an alarm device connected to a communication network and arranged in the vicinity of a user. The method includes receiving voice data generated by the user, comparing the received voice data with voice data recorded in the alarm device, and, when the received voice data matches recorded voice data, transmitting to a server, via the communication network, textual information known to the server, in order to request assistance for the user, the textual information being non-representative of the voice data generated by the user.

High Security Two-Way Virtual Cross-Barrier Observation and Communication Device
20220132073 · 2022-04-28 ·

A high security two-way virtual cross-barrier observation and communication device has a mounting frame with a hardened core, a pair of digital displays, and a pair of cameras. The mounting frame may correspond to a typical interior door of a building or a relevant component of a vehicle, aircraft, or other relevant application. The hardened core is bullet-resistant and fire-resistant to protect occupants of a protected space from harm. The digital displays and cameras are positioned on opposing sides of the mounting frame, each camera transmitting a live video feed to the opposing display, creating the appearance of a window while protecting occupants. The digital displays may be used to display any desired information. An emergency protocol may be activated to communicate with emergency services. A plurality of laminate layers bond and encapsulate the displays and cameras to the hardened core, forming a rugged, self-contained unit with no moving parts.

Emergency communications system
11315408 · 2022-04-26 · ·

According to an embodiment, an emergency communication (EC) system includes an emergency notification application for generating and receiving one or more emergency notification messages; a Websocket server for connecting one or more computing devices configured with the emergency notification application; a cloud-based storage server, wherein the storage server is configured for storing a plurality of rules for determining one or more actions to be taken in an emergency; and one or more communication channel identifiers for distributing the emergency notification messages to the one or more computing devices.

INFORMATION PROCESSING SYSTEM AND INFORMATION PROCESSING METHOD
20220122442 · 2022-04-21 ·

An information processing system includes: a receiver that receives a signal transmitted by a call button including a push button, and a communicator which transmits the signal outside in response to detection of an operation performed on the push button by a user; and an outputter that outputs (i) first notification information, when the signal is received in a first time period within a predetermined period, and (ii) second notification information different from the first notification information, when the signal is received in a second time period within the predetermined period which is different from the first time period.
